Json

Management of JSON data for NO SQL projects

Archivos JSON

Haga su sistema de información compatible con los formatos «NoSQL»

JSON se ha convertido en un formato de intercambio indispensable. La mayoría de las API lo utiliza para intercambiar datos con aplicaciones de terceros.

Gracias a su principio de «mapping universal», Stambia permite manipular fácilmente cualquier tipo de estructura de datos.

De este modo, la gestión de archivos JSON con Stambia resulta sorprendentemente fácil y es muy apreciada por los usuarios. Stambia puede revertir este tipo de archivo, directamente desde el archivo o mediante la definición de un servicio web.

 

 

Escritura de datos JSON

Stambia puede gestionar archivos JSON, como fuentes o destinos de un mapping, de una forma eficaz y fácil de diseñar.

En un único mapping, Stambia es capaz de cargar archivos JSON complejos, independientemente de la profundidad o del número de jerarquías.

 

Lectura de datos JSON

Del mismo modo, gracias al enfoque multidestino del mapping, Stambia puede leer archivos JSON complejos y cargarlos en varios destinos.

Cada archivo será leído una única vez para ofrecer el máximo rendimiento.

 

Replicación de archivos JSON

Combinado con el componente de réplica Stambia, el conector permite reproducir un modelo jerárquico JSON en una base de datos relacional estándar.

Este componente permite explorar un directorio e integrar masivamente archivos JSON en una base de datos relacional. En ese caso no hay mapping ni desarrollo. El replicador es capaz de crear una estructura relacional a partir de la organización jerárquica del archivo, y de proveer la base de datos con los archivos encontrados en la carpeta.

De este modo, la lectura y la escritura de un archivo JSON son automáticas y no requieren desarrollos complejos.

 

JSON y los servicios web

JSON también puede ser la entrada o la salida de un servicio web. El modo de gestionar el formato JSON será la misma que en un mapping con un formato de intercambio XML.

Stambia puede revertir directamente la descripción del servicio web, incluida la definición de JSON.

Si la definición del servicio web no ofrece la definición JSON de entrada o de salida, es posible asociar una definición del archivo JSON a la definición del servicio web a fin de completar la metadata.

En ese caso, los mapping resultan muy fáciles de implementar.